What are Online Insurance Quotes?
Online insurance quotes are estimates of the cost of an insurance policy, provided by insurance companies or comparison websites. They are based on the information you provide about yourself, your assets, and your desired coverage. These quotes are typically free and easy to obtain.

Types of Insurance You Can Get Quotes for Online:
You can find online quotes for a wide variety of insurance types, including:
- Auto Insurance: Protects your vehicle and provides liability coverage in case of an accident.
- Homeowners Insurance: Covers your home and belongings against damage or loss due to covered perils like fire, theft, and natural disasters.
- Renters Insurance: Protects your personal belongings and provides liability coverage if you rent an apartment or home.
- Health Insurance: Covers medical expenses, including doctor visits, hospital stays, and prescription drugs.
- Life Insurance: Provides financial protection for your loved ones in the event of your death.
- Business Insurance: Protects your business from various risks, such as property damage, liability claims, and business interruption.
- Travel Insurance: Covers medical emergencies, trip cancellations, and lost luggage while traveling.
- Pet Insurance: Helps cover the cost of veterinary care for your furry friends.
How to Get Insurance Quotes Online:
The process of getting insurance quotes online is generally straightforward:
- Choose a Platform: You can get quotes directly from insurance company websites or use comparison websites. Comparison websites allow you to compare quotes from multiple insurers in one place. Research and choose a reputable platform.
- Provide Information: You will be asked to provide information about yourself, your assets, and your desired coverage. The specific information required will vary depending on the type of insurance. Be prepared to provide details such as:
- Personal Information: Name, address, date of birth, etc.
- Vehicle Information (for auto insurance): Year, make, model, VIN, driving history.
- Property Information (for homeowners/renters insurance): Address, square footage, construction type.
- Health Information (for health insurance): Age, pre-existing conditions, family medical history.
- Coverage Needs: Desired coverage limits, deductibles, and any additional features.
- Receive Quotes: Once you submit your information, you will receive quotes from various insurers. These quotes will include the premium (the cost of the insurance), the coverage limits, and the deductible (the amount you pay out-of-pocket before the insurance kicks in).
- Compare Quotes: Carefully compare the quotes you receive. Pay attention to the coverage details, the premiums, and the deductibles. Consider the reputation and financial strength of the insurance companies.
- Choose a Policy: Select the policy that best meets your needs and budget.
- Apply and Purchase: Once you’ve chosen a policy, you can typically apply and purchase it online. You may need to provide additional information and documentation.
- Review and Renew: Regularly review your insurance policy to ensure it still meets your needs. Renew your policy before it expires.
Tips for Getting the Best Insurance Quotes Online:
- Be Accurate and Honest: Provide accurate and honest information when requesting quotes. Misrepresenting information can lead to denial of coverage or cancellation of your policy.
- Shop Around: Don’t settle for the first quote you receive. Compare quotes from multiple insurers to ensure you’re getting the best deal.
- Understand Your Needs: Determine the type of coverage you need and the level of protection you require. This will help you choose the right policy.
- Consider Deductibles: A higher deductible typically means a lower premium, but you’ll pay more out-of-pocket in the event of a claim. Choose a deductible you can afford.
- Read the Fine Print: Carefully review the policy details, including the coverage exclusions and limitations.
- Check the Insurer’s Reputation: Research the insurance company’s financial strength and customer service ratings.
- Ask Questions: Don’t hesitate to ask questions if you don’t understand something. Contact the insurer or a licensed insurance agent for clarification.
- Bundle Policies: Many insurers offer discounts if you bundle multiple policies, such as auto and homeowners insurance.
- Review Your Coverage Annually: Insurance needs can change over time. Review your coverage annually to ensure it still meets your needs.
- Consider a Local Agent: While online quotes are convenient, working with a local insurance agent can provide personalized advice and assistance. They can help you navigate the complexities of insurance and find the right coverage for your specific needs.

Things to Consider When Choosing an Insurance Policy:
- Coverage Limits: The maximum amount the insurance company will pay for a covered loss. Choose limits that are adequate to protect your assets.
- Deductible: The amount you pay out-of-pocket before the insurance company starts paying. Choose a deductible you can afford.
- Premiums: The cost of the insurance policy. Compare premiums from different insurers to find the best deal.
- Exclusions: The events or circumstances that are not covered by the policy.
- Policy Terms and Conditions: Carefully review the policy details, including the coverage, exclusions, and limitations.
- Customer Service: Choose an insurer with a good reputation for customer service.
- Financial Strength: Choose an insurer that is financially stable and able to pay claims.
